Java编程:经典实例解析——判断闰年与评分等级

需积分: 49 1 下载量 184 浏览量 更新于2024-07-23 1 收藏 201KB PDF 举报
"thismarkisgrade\'B\'"; elseif(mark>=70)System.out.println("thismarkisgrade\'C\'"); elseif(mark>=60)System.out.println("thismarkisgrade\'D\'"); elseSystem.out.println("thismarkisgrade\'E\'"); } } ` "这个资源包含100个经典的Java编程示例,旨在帮助学习者巩固和深化Java编程技能。其中,两个例子分别是判断闰年和根据分数输出相应等级的程序。" 在Java编程中,理解和编写实用的程序是非常重要的实践环节。这两个例子分别展示了基础的逻辑判断和输入处理技巧,这是所有编程语言中的核心技能。 1. **判断闰年**: - 这个程序使用了条件语句(if-else)来判断用户输入的年份是否为闰年。闰年的规则涉及到了对年份进行模运算(%),这是数学在编程中的应用。 - `Scanner` 类用于获取用户从控制台输入的年份,这是Java标准库提供的IO工具,方便用户交互。 - `System.exit(0)` 用于在条件不满足时终止程序,这是程序控制流程的一部分。 - 注意程序对输入范围的检查(年份在0到3000之间),这是防止异常输入的有效做法。 2. **根据分数输出等级**: - 这个程序接收用户输入的百分制分数,然后通过一系列的if-else语句判断并输出相应的等级。 - `nextDouble()` 方法用于读取用户的浮点数输入,确保可以处理带有小数的分数。 - 同样使用了 `Scanner` 类来实现用户与程序的交互。 - 在条件判断中,使用了区间来划分等级,这是一种常见的逻辑处理方式,也体现了问题解决的策略。 这两个例子展示了Java基本语法、条件控制结构、输入输出处理等基础知识,同时也展现了如何利用这些知识来解决实际问题。对于初学者来说,通过实践这些示例,不仅可以掌握基本的编程技能,还能锻炼逻辑思维能力。在深入学习Java或其他编程语言的过程中,这样的实践案例是不可或缺的。通过不断练习,开发者能够逐步提升编程技能,理解更复杂的编程概念,并最终能够独立设计和实现功能丰富的应用程序。